As the world turns, so do we...
Where does the tide go,
When it rolls back off the sand?

Where does the sun go,
When it sinks beneath the land?

What happens to time,
As it slowly ticks away?

If the clouds keep rolling,
Then will they stop someday?

These things are naught but memories,
Once they've come and gone

Are not our lives the same,
When we our course have run?

Tarry not too long in life,
With things you don't hold dear

For if at first a moment's there,
It will soon disappear

We are given time in life,
To enjoy what we see

But it won't take long for all of this,
To become a memory

Our friends, families, deeds we've done,
May not tarry long when we our course have run

The guiding light of distant shores,
Will still show us the way

If we could only think about,
The joys of today

We're never guaranteed for sure,
That tomorrow will come

But if it doesn't we will know,
That we our course have run.
